Atalanta boss Edy Reja unhappy with performance against Juventus

Atalanta manager Edy Reja is left unhappy by his team's performance following a 2-0 away defeat to Serie A champions Juventus.

Atalanta BC manager Edy Reja has criticised his team's performance during their 2-0 away defeat to Juventus.

The hosts have struggled this season and went into the game 14th in Serie A, but came out winners against Atalanta thanks to goals from Paulo Dybala and Mario Mandzukic.

Despite insisting that his side would not underestimate the Italian champions earlier this week, he was left disappointed by the display on offer from La Dea.

"We were unfortunate to face a resurgent Juve," he told Rai Sport. "We tried to attack but coming to Turin is always very difficult.

"To make things worse Juventus had an in-form Dybala who scored a ridiculous goal that came when we were in the ascendency.

"We started well but we became far too tentative to even hope to rescue a point. I was hoping for a lot more personality and character from my team."

Atalanta sit ninth in Serie A, and are next in action against Lazio on Wednesday.
